As previously reported, the media was abuzz with news that Shyne had allegedly inked a seven figure deal with Def Jam and now less than a week later there is confirmation.The Chairman of Island Def Jam Records and music industry figure head, L.A. Reid, made a special trip to Belize Monday to officially sign Shyne Po after a nearly 8 year hiatus.
Speaking on his decision to bring Shyne back into the Def Jam family he told 7NewsBelize,
“I have come here to stand by Shyne and to officially kick off our partnership with Island Def Jam Music Group and Gangland Records and so it is really an honor to be here, really very special place.”
Shyne also expressed his sentiments on his new deal, telling 7NewsBelize,
“It is an honor and a pleasure, not just for me but for Belize. Chairman Reid is on the level of Berry Gordy, Clive Davis, the biggest music men in the history of music, and so to have a partnership with Gangland Records and Island/Def Jam is incredible for me.”
Gangland Records is a subsidiary of Island Def Jam.
